Transaction

9809181a8b2d0cdb39422f44e9bebc3c3e6ab84970fb4fa452b0e97aaf74ecdf
505,639 confirmations
Timestamp
1477103539
Block435,358
Fee21,261 sats
Fee rate56.8 sats/vB
view on mempool.space

Inputs & Outputs